Things People Often Misunderstand

One widespread misconception is that Amtrak Police operate exactly like local city police in every respect. In reality, their authority is limited to areas directly associated with Amtrak operations. This includes trains, stations, and other properties owned or leased by the company. Confusing these boundaries can lead to unrealistic assumptions about their role. Clarifying this distinction is a key part of Unmasking the Amtrak Police: Separating Fact from Fiction.

Another common error involves the perception of secrecy or lack of oversight. Some people assume that federal law enforcement agencies operate without accountability. In practice, Amtrak Police are subject to federal regulations, internal reviews, and external oversight mechanisms. Reports and summaries may be published periodically to highlight activities and improvements. Understanding these structures helps counter misinformation and fosters a more accurate perspective.

Travelers may also misunderstand the nature of routine procedures such as inspections or inquiries. These actions are typically conducted according to established protocols designed to ensure safety for all passengers. They are not arbitrary or targeted without cause.
